RTE+RRTMGP is a set of codes for computing radiative fluxes in planetary atmospheres. RRTMGP uses a k-distribution to provide an optical description (absorption and possibly Rayleigh optical depth) of the gaseous atmosphere, along with the relevant source functions, on a pre-determined spectral grid given temperatures, pressures, and gas concentration. RTE computes fluxes given spectrally-resolved optical descriptions and source functions.
